johnparker007 Posted February 12, 2021 Author Report Share Posted February 12, 2021 (edited) Finding some very handy info scanning through this collection of flyers @A:E has kindly sent So I now realise that PCP only manufactured 'kits' to apply to other manufacturers cabinets (which explains how I was seeing PCP games in what appeared to be Smash n Grab type cabinets... I thought they might be sister companies, or share the same cabinet builder - but this all makes much more sense!
